There is'one game'for Thursday's MLB playoff slate (October 20), and we've identified a few favorable baseball'player prop bets'on the'BetMGM Sportsbook'that you could consider ahead of today's action.

Aaron Judge Over 1.5 Bases (+115)

As always, Judge is likely to be one to watch in today's matchup. Having batted .311 with an OBP of .425 through the regular season, the outfielder has been inundated with media attention as he battled to beat the Yankees single-season home run record (which he did). In Game 2 of the ALCS, Judge should be able to do what he does best and heat up at the plate – and he will need to if the Yankees wants to catch up to the Astros.

Houston's Framber Valdez will be starting on the mound today, and this will be his second time this season throwing to Judge. With an ERA of 2.82 through the regular season and six strikeouts in his last playoff outing, Valdez will almost certainly be a challenge for Judge to overcome. Regardless, I think two bases is very doable.

At +115, the money could be better, but for 1.5 bases, I love the prop.
